짝수 값만 출력하는 방법은 이해했습니다. 하지만 여기서 짝수 항만 출력하는 방법도 있는지 궁금하네요!
여러 방법이 있습니다
가장 간단하게는 파이썬 내장 슬라이싱 기능을 사용하는 것입니다
파이썬의 리스트 슬라이싱에 step
파라미터를 활용하면 원하는 간격으로 요소를 추출할 수 있습니다
짝수 번째 항목을 출력하려면 step=2
로 설정하면 됩니다
import numpy as np
numbers_array = np.arange(1, 101)
even_index_array = numbers_array[::2]
even_index_array
슬라이싱 문법은 다음과 같습니다:
sequence[start:stop:step]
- start -> 시작 인덱스 (생략하면 기본값 0)
- stop -> 해당 인덱스 전까지
- step -> 간격 (생략하면 기본값 1)
강의실 우측 상단의 AI GURU를 이용하시면 더 빠른 답변을 받으실 수 있습니다 :)